In late January, we announced that Bridgefield Capital signed an agreement to acquire Philips’ Emergency Care business which includes leading brands and products like HeartStart AEDs, Intrepid and DFM100 monitor defibrillators, Tempus monitor and Tempus ALS systems, and Corsium and ECI informatics solutions. We expect the transaction to close at the end of 2025.

With Bridgefield’s support and building on our 40+ year legacy of growth and innovation in emergency medical technology, the Emergency Care business will continue passionately pursuing our mission of saving lives, lowering the cost of healthcare, and advancing the science of resuscitation while serving the public access AED, EMS, military, and hospital market segments.

As an individual contributor, you will leverage your experience in the evaluation, development, and negotiation of commercial transactions, contracts, proposals, and quotes while ensuring compliance with current policies and procedures and minimizing contractual risk.

Your role:

  • Serve as a trusted advisor to stakeholders, creating contract solutions that minimize risk, ensure compliance, and deliver customer value.
  • Negotiate and manage sales and service agreements (capital equipment, consumables, SaaS, consulting, etc.) in partnership with internal teams.
  • Support proposal processes (RFPs, RFIs, RFQs) while streamlining policies and procedures to align with business requirements.
  • Provide guidance on contractual rights and obligations, and lead process improvement initiatives to enhance efficiency and standardization.

You're the right fit if:

  • You have a Bachelor’s degree (required), with a Paralegal, Certified Contract Management (CCM) [or other contract management certification], or Juris Doctor (J.D.) desired.
  • You have a minimum of5+ years of experience drafting, reviewing, and negotiating commercial contracts (or a combination of experience and education).
  • Your skills include proficiency in MS Office (Excel skills are required); Saleforce.com (SFDC),
  • Contract Lifecycle Management (CLM) tools (preferred, with the ability to learn quickly). Additional skills in Lean methodology.Project management with solid analytical and negotiation skills required.

The pay range for this position in AZ, AR, ID, IA, KS, KY, LA, ME, MS, MO, NE, NM, OK, SC, SD, TN, UT, or WV is $71,250 to $114,000.

The pay range for this position in AL, CO, FL, GA, HI, IL, IN, MI, MN, NV, NH, NC, ND, OH, OR, PA, TX, VT, VA, WI, or WY is $75,000 to $120,000.

The pay range for this position in AK, DE, MD, NY, RI, or WA is $78,750 to 126,000.

The pay range for this position in CA, CT, DC, MA, or NJ is $84,000 to 134,400.

The actual base pay offered may vary within the posted ranges depending on multiple factors including job-related knowledge/skills, experience, business needs, geographical location, and internal equity.

In addition, other compensation, such as an annual incentive bonus, sales commission or long-term incentives may be offered. Employees are eligible to participate in our comprehensive Philips Total Rewards benefits program, which includes a generous PTO, 401k (up to 7% match), HSA (with company contribution), stock purchase plan, education reimbursement and much more.
